Intermediate Results Indicator
Fiscal discipline maintained through reduction in the non-oil deficit as a % of GDP.
Non-oil fiscal deficit as a % of non oil GDP in 2009 = 71.1
Partially met. While dropping to roughly 80% and below 2011 and 2012, the deficit increased to 98% of non-oil GDP based on adownward revision to estimated 2013 non-oil GDP. Much of the volatility in this indicator stems from volatility and revisions tothe non-oil GDP figure.
Partially met. While dropping to roughly 80% and below 2011 and 2012, the deficit increased to 98% of non-oil GDP based on adownward revision to estimated 2013 non-oil GDP. Much of the volatility in this indicator stems from volatility and revisions tothe non-oil GDP figure.
Intermediate Results Indicator
Aggregate revenue and expenditure outturn # 80% of budget in the last two years
Partially met. While revenue has strongly overperformed, expenditure outturns have fallen below 85%. While execution of therecurrent budget remains above 95%, infrastructure spending has fallen following the completion of large projects, notablyelectrification. Lowering of budgets, and continued improvements to execution capacity are likely to mean overall execution ratesrise sharply to over 85% in 2014.
Partially met (Revenue outturn systematically exceding targets, but expenditure outturn in FY12 below 80%, and remaining below,albeit closer to, 80% in 2013). Measures to improve budget credibility are taking effect, as budgets are reduced into line with(rising) spending capacity.
Intermediate Results Indicator
# Quarterly publication of budget execution reports within two months of the end of the quarter.
This indicator is met. The transparency portal has been steadily improved, now including more data (e.g.execution rates by allclassifications), and with greater accessibility of reports (including full data downloads). Civil society used it to proposequestions for Parliamentarians during the budget debate.
